AUSTRALIA'S ARMY.
— * irPROPOSED INCREASE COMMENDED. By Telegraph—Press Association—Copyright • t ■ :! • Sydney, April 2. Tile 'Sydney Morning Herald," in commending the proposed increase in tho Australian army, says:—"lt is an axiom that the existence of the Empire depends primarily on adequate and efficient naval forces, and tho presence in Australian waters of tho magnificent cruiser New Zealand reminds us of the share tho Dominions are taking in the burden of naval defence. But it is nono the less necessary that tli.ero should bo adequate armies on land."
